 Use of Acetyl-(Tyr1,D-Phe2)-GRF (1-29) amide


[Ac-Tyr1,D-Phe2]GRF 1-29, amide (human), a growth hormone releasing factor (GRF) analogue, is a vasoactive intestinal peptide (VIP) antagonist[1].
